Microsoft Security Essentials 2011

Microsoft has released Beta version of its FREE Antivirus and antispyware program “Microsoft Security Essentials” (MSE) 2.0. Along with integration with Windows firewall (asking to turn on/off Windows Firewall during setup), Microsoft Security Essentials boasts of enhanced protection against web-based threats, a new anti-malware engine, better performance, and added protection against network-based exploits. It have New protection engine – updated anti-malware engine offers enhanced detection and cleanup capabilities with better performance » Network inspection system – Protection against network-based exploits is now built in to MSE. Now moving on to the main point of this Microsoft Security Essentials review, let us discuss its security features and performance. MSE is on par with the best in the business when it comes to detecting malware. In real time scanning mode, it detects most malware programs before they can get activated on your system. The antivirus and anti spyware engines along with the rootkit protection are some of the other useful tools. What is lacking is email scanners, web protection and a firewall.
